Community corrections
Average daily community corrections populations, 1999-2000 and 2000-2001*
*Excludes Victoria.
Source: Steering Committee for the Review of Commonwealth/State Government Service Provision 2002, Report on government services 2002, vol. 1, Productivity Commission, Canberra.
What this chart shows
- Supervision orders are the most commonly used option, with 34,279 offenders under supervision orders in 2000-2001 (excluding Victoria). This represents a 7% increase on the number recorded in 1999-2000.
- Reparation orders are also common, with 22,967 offenders serving this option in 2000-2001 (excluding Victoria), a decline from 25,362 reparation orders in 1999-2000.
